Understanding the Regulatory Environment in Australia

Unlike many jurisdictions, Australia’s gambling laws are state-based, with the Australian Communications and Media Authority (ACMA) overseeing online licensing and compliance. Over recent years, government bodies have introduced tightening regulations, especially concerning player verification and responsible gambling measures. The focus has shifted towards transparency and safeguarding user data, aligning with global standards like AML (Anti-Money Laundering) and KYC (Know Your Customer).

Key Point: A rigorous registration process underpins Australia’s approach to combat gambling addiction and facilitate wagering integrity.
